A few things seem to stand up re:health:

- inflammation > bad
- move your body regularly
- eat plants/produce

There is a good amount of variety in diets of different groups. There are healthy populations that eat high carb and some that eat high fat. A lot of people don't digest dairy well.

I can't think of any that are known to thrive on a high sugar diet. Such a thing wasn't even really possible for most of our existence as a species. There was honey, fruit in season, and in some places dairy. For a long time granulated sugar and molasses were luxury items used sparingly.

Moderating sugar intake > reasonable.

Eliminating all sugar intake > unnecessary for most of us.

Most of that is only true in the context of a sedentary person eating excess calories, especially on top of a nutritionally inadequate diet. That can be easy to do when eating palatable, calorie-dense things.

But like my fellow INTP ITT mentioned, if you are active and eat plenty of vegetables, protein, etc., some added sugar is totally fine. Most nutritionists recommend below 10% of daily calories from added sugar, which, if you have a high TDEE from sports, is actually a LOT. I mean, say you need 3,000 or 4,000 calories a day. That means you could eat 75 or 100 grams of pure sugar and be fine.

Basically, you guys (the already-fit) are not the target audience for this documentary.

Inflammation is not bad, that's one of those silly vegan narratives. Inflammation is important as a repair signal, crucial for weightlifting. Chronic inflammation is the problem, there needs to be a balance between inflammation and anti-inflammation.

As for sugar, all carbs are broken down in the stomach into sugars including starchy carbs. So we aren't actually talking about sugar, we are talking about over-eating and malnutrition. People who eat heavily processed diets aren't unhealthy due to the sugar content, they are unhealthy because they usually over-eat and because a highly processed diet does not have any margin left for the nutrients needed in a diet.

However if you eat the odd processed food in an otherwise balanced diet, without any overconsumption of calories, then the sugar will have no NO adverse health effects.
